On Thursday all four of us took a snorkeling trip to different places with a long tail boat. We snorkeled in some bay, saw Maya Beach (The Beach), Monkey Beach with lots of overfed monkeys and a very bad snorkeling place with dead corals and too low water. But anyway it was a fun day and it was fun to do something other than just lie on the beach.
